Suppose that the given function is
f:X → Y
Then, if function 'f' is one-to-one and onto function (a needed condition for inverses to exist), then, the inverse of the considered function is
f⁻¹: Y → X
such that:
[tex]\forall \: x \in X : f(x) \in Y, \exists \: y \in Y : f^{-1}(y) \in X[/tex]
(and vice versa).
It simply means, inverse of 'f' is undo operator, that takes back the effect of 'f'.
If the f(x) = 5x - 3, then the inverse function of the f(x) will be
g(x) = f⁻¹(x)
Then we have
5g(x) - 3 = x
5g(x) = x + 3
g(x) = (x + 3) / 5
